The Role of Additives in Ready Mix Concrete

Ready Mix Concrete (RMC) has transformed the construction industry by offering a convenient, consistent, and high-quality solution for projects of all sizes. But what truly elevates RMC beyond a simple mix of cement, water, and aggregates is the strategic use of additives, also known as admixtures. These substances, added in precise amounts during the batching process, play a crucial role in enhancing the performance, durability, and sustainability of Ready Mix Concrete.

What Are the Additives in Ready Mix Concrete?

Additives are materials added to the concrete mix to modify its properties — either while it’s still in the plastic (wet) state or after it hardens. They come in two main types:

  • Chemical admixtures: These are compounds added in small quantities to influence setting time, workability, water content, and more.
  • Mineral admixtures: These are fine powders, like fly ash or silica fume, added to replace a portion of cement, improving performance and sustainability.

The careful selection and proportioning of additives in Ready Mix Concrete allow for tailor-made solutions that meet specific project demands, site conditions, and environmental requirements.

Improving Workability and Flow

One of the top advantages of RMC is its ability to be transported from a batching plant to the job site — sometimes over long distances. Additives help maintain the concrete’s workability during transit. Water-reducing agents and superplasticizers are commonly used to improve the flow of concrete without increasing its water content, which can weaken the final product.

These additives ensure that Ready Mix Concrete remains easy to pour and finish, even in complex forms or tightly spaced reinforcement. For high-rise buildings or intricate architectural elements, these flow-enhancing properties are essential.

Controlling Setting Time

Weather, timeline, and transport time can all affect the setting behavior of RMC. Set retarders are added to slow the hardening process, which is especially useful in hot climates or when delivery takes longer than usual. Accelerators, on the other hand, speed up setting and early strength development, ideal for cold-weather pours or projects that require quick turnaround times.

By managing the set time, additives help prevent costly delays and improve the overall scheduling and efficiency of construction projects.

Enhancing Strength and Durability

Ready Mix Concrete is often used in structural components where strength and long-term durability are non-negotiable. Additives play a major role in boosting these characteristics. Silica fume, fly ash, and slag cement are mineral admixtures that improve compressive strength, reduce permeability, and increase resistance to chemical attack.

Air-entraining agents are another critical additive, especially for concrete used in freeze-thaw environments. These create tiny air bubbles that allow water to expand and contract without damaging the concrete. The result is a longer-lasting, more resilient structure.

Supporting Sustainable Construction

Sustainability is increasingly important in the construction industry, and additives contribute directly to greener concrete. By incorporating industrial byproducts like fly ash and slag as partial cement replacements, Ready Mix Concrete producers can lower the carbon footprint of each cubic yard of concrete.

In addition, water-reducing additives decrease the amount of fresh water needed in a mix, while durability-enhancing admixtures help structures last longer, reducing the need for repairs or early replacement. These innovations support LEED certification and other green building goals.

Tailoring Concrete for Specialized Applications

Additives allow RMC producers to create specialty mixes for everything from bridge decks to industrial floors. Shrinkage-reducing admixtures help prevent cracking, corrosion inhibitors protect embedded steel in marine or de-icing environments, and waterproofing agents improve performance in basements and foundations.

Because Ready Mix Concrete is batched under controlled conditions, these additives can be precisely dosed, ensuring consistent results and high performance across batches.
